Exhibitor Preview + FEB 2012 + Gentle Fawn + 10 Years of Margin

Thursday, January 26th, 2012

Gentle Fawn

GENTLE FAWN
North American Gentle Fawn originally made their UK trade debut at Margin back in 2004, and we’re pleased to welcome them back to the 10 year show in February 2012 with their desirable range of versatile womenswear. Well-designed and impeccably-executed, the range of clothing and accessories sits well in all types of boutique, from designer-led to more casual. From stylish outwear to evening dresses, Gentle Fawn produce a understated, highly-wearable range of wardrobe essentials.

Exhibitor Preview + FEB 2012 + Shara + 10 Years of Margin

Thursday, January 26th, 2012

Shara

SHARA
Exhibiting at Margin in February, Shara will be showcasing their latest range of affordable glamour. With a passion for exotic colour and luxe fabrics, from chiffons to crepe satins, Shara drapes and embellishes with delicate embroideries to create a range of feminine dresses. With a strong belief in ‘Fashion with Heart’, Shara donates a portion of profits to a children’s charity to help orphans.

Exhibitor Preview + FEB 2012 + PRETTY DISTURBIA + 10 Years of Margin

Thursday, January 26th, 2012

PRETTY DISTURBIA

PRETTY DISTURBIA
Burlesque glamour with vintage influences and a sinister gothic edge translates into a unique range from Manchester label Pretty Disturbia. Exhibiting their womenswear at Margin in February 2012, Pretty Disturbia offer a full range, including tees, tops, blouses, skirts, leggings, dresses, and jackets, which feature embellishments applied by hand and bespoke detailing.

Exhibitor Preview + FEB 2012 + AsakeOge + 10 Years of Margin

Thursday, January 26th, 2012

AsakeOge

ASAKEOGE
AsakeOge will be launching their new range of glamourous dresses created from French silk and silk jersey at Margin in February 2012. A bold colour palette inspired by tropical climes and African fabrics infuses artfully cut and draped dresses, from red-carpet worthy pieces to daywear.With a made-to-measure service available, AsakeOge are able to offer exclusivity to shoppers.

Exhibitor Preview + FEB 2012 + Silas + 10 Years of Margin

Monday, January 9th, 2012

Silas & Maria

SILAS
After an absence of some years when the label was only available in Japan, seminal streetwear label Silas returned to the UK when they exhibited their menswear at Margin in August 2010 & February 2011. Following the successful re-introduction of the brand to Europe, Silas are now bringing their womenswear back to the UK. Silas will be making their European trade debut with their collection of women’s clothing and accessories exclusively at the 10 year edition of Margin in February 2012. Highly wearable pieces, that quickly become wardrobe favourites, transcend age groups and sit well in all types of boutique.

Exhibitor Preview + FEB 2012 + No Love Lost + 10 Years of Margin

Monday, January 9th, 2012

NO LOVE LOST

NO LOVE LOST
Hailing from Aberdeenshire in Scotland, No Love Lost is a brand new textile-driven label making their global debut exclusively at the 10 year edition of Margin in February 2012. Driven by a passion for graphic design and inspired by heirloom scarves, No Love Lost takes traditional fabrics such as tartan and gives them a digital twist to produce contemporary textiles on modern silhouettes. The combination of edgy prints on soft flowing silks in simple shapes has produced a winning collection of desirable clothing by No Love Lost.

Exhibitor Preview + FEB 2012 + Slow Dance + 10 Years of Margin

Monday, January 9th, 2012

SLOW DANCE

SLOW DANCE
Making their European trade debut at the 10 year edition of Margin in February 2012, Slow Dance from Tokyo in Japan will be exhibiting their, quite frankly, dreamy range of womenswear. Creative pattern-cutting has produced a romantic range that is not only unique but also highly flattering with well-placed draping and swagging to hide those “problem” areas. All made in Japan from Japanese textiles, somehow Slow Dance pulls off the neat magic trick of being simultaneously relaxed yet dressy. Launched in 2009, Margin is pleased to welcome Slow Dance to the UK to present their trade debut outside of Japan as part of the long-running exchange programme with the IFF show in Tokyo.

Exhibitor Preview + FEB 2012 + Silent Wood + 10 Years of Margin

Monday, January 9th, 2012

SILENT WOOD

SILENT WOOD
Silent Wood is a Moscow-based art collective known for their films, photography and art, who have now turned their talent to clothing. The debut collection consists of dresses in various fabric and colour combinations using high-quality textiles, and beautiful linings, that are comfortably simple yet elegant. Silent Wood will be making their trade debut outside of Russia at the 10 year edition of Margin in February 2012.

Exhibitor Preview + FEB 2012 + Thom Will Love + 10 Years of Margin

Monday, January 9th, 2012

THOM WILL LOVE

THOM WILL LOVE
Making their global trade debut at Margin, Thom Will Love is a new lifestyle brand making sports-inspired clothing for men and women. Designed and made in London from carefully-selected high quality and performance fabrics, Thom Will Love combines bold asymetric colour blocking with monochrome tones and classic shapes to create future-inspired streetwear.
